Diesel XC90 - Wastegate Stuck open ?
My wifes 2003 XC90 has just had to have the crank seal replaced at only 50k (I mention that in case its related) and we noticed that if we blip the throttle hard there is a dump valve noise coming from the air filter box.
A volvo specialist has had a look and thinks the wastegate is stuck open and thinks we need a new turbo. Has anyone has an experience of this ? It seems strange to me that the wastegate can't be freed up but I am only familiar with older petrol turbos. Any advice welcome even if it only for a recon specialist. |

The wastegate as such is controlled by an electric motor they dont stick .. If there is a lack of power too , they have not fitted a boost pipe properly and it has blown off, take a look ...you may be able to refit it yourself .. failing that look for a split intercooler or a missing air filter ...
